Where is The Simpsons’ Springfield

By Tangotiger, 03:24 PM

Once you accept this constraint:

The Simpsons Movie has Ned Flanders showing Bart the four states which border Springfield: Ohio, Nevada, Maine and Kentucky. It would be difficult to pick four states further apart from one another, which makes the entire thing an obvious joke. On the other hand, since Ned is not a particularly unreliable narrator, it is vaguely conceivable that this is actually TRUE, which, combined with the evidence for [8F01] Mr. Lisa Goes To Washington and [5F21] The Wizard Of Evergreen Terrace (both listed above), leads to the unavoidable conclusion that the layout of US states in the Simpsons universe is different from our own.

So, you need to proceed as if the names of the states and its possessions are accurate (i.e., there is a Kansas), but just not where our universe says it should be. All you have to do is cross out the states that they can’t be in, like here:

Who Shot Mr. Burns? (Part Two) Chief Wiggum remarks, “No jury in the world’s going to convict a baby. Mmm...maybe Texas.” Springfield can’t be in Texas.

You can figure out which state it is.  Unless of course this deductive reasoning crosses out all the states and possessions.
